Luxembourg - 17 Year-Olds Enrolment Rate in Secondary and Tertiary Education
Since 2014, Luxembourg 17 Year-Olds Enrolment Rate in Secondary and Tertiary Education was up 0.4points year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 37 comparing other countries in 17 Year-Olds Enrolment Rate in Secondary and Tertiary Education with 81.66 Percent of Relevant Age Group. Luxembourg is overtaken by Argentina, which was number 36 at 84.19 Percent of Relevant Age Group and is followed by Turkey at 81.3 Percent of Relevant Age Group. Estonia ranked the highest with 101.98 Percent of Relevant Age Group in 2019, +8.9points compared to 2018. Sweden, Lithuania and Portugal resp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Colombia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+3.7points per year, while Saudi Arabia was the worst growing country at -1.7points per year.
